
CAS 1286264-50-3
:4-Piperidinamine, 1-[(4-bromophenyl)methyl]-, hydrochloride (1:2)
Description:
4-Piperidinamine, 1-[(4-bromophenyl)methyl]-, hydrochloride (1:2) is a chemical compound characterized by its piperidine ring structure, which is a six-membered saturated nitrogen-containing heterocycle. The presence of a bromophenyl group indicates that a bromine atom is substituted on a phenyl ring, contributing to the compound's potential biological activity. As a hydrochloride salt, it is typically more soluble in water, enhancing its utility in pharmaceutical applications. This compound may exhibit properties such as being a potential intermediate in organic synthesis or a candidate for drug development, particularly in the context of medicinal chemistry. Its molecular structure suggests it may interact with biological targets, making it of interest in research related to pharmacology. Formula:C12H17BrN2·2ClH
InChI:InChI=1S/C12H17BrN2.2ClH/c13-11-3-1-10(2-4-11)9-15-7-5-12(14)6-8-15;;/h1-4,12H,5-9,14H2;2*1H
InChI key:InChIKey=MHRXUROVGRCLNB-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(C1=CC=C(Br)C=C1)N2CCC(N)CC2.Cl
